Common Pests in San Antonio

Many pests in the San Antonio area, such as crickets, are not dangerous. Some, such as bats and scorpions, can pose a serious health risk for you and your loved ones. Here are some common pests in the area you may want to seek help with:

Ants: Ants can quickly take over your home by building colonies and going after crumbs in your kitchen. Some types of ants, like carpenter ants, can cause structural damage. In San Antonio, fire ants and their painful bites may also be a concern. Mosquitoes: These common Texas pests are able to spread dangerous diseases, such as West Nile and Zika. Cockroaches: Cockroaches are adaptable scavengers that contaminate your food, stain surfaces, destroy fabric, and spread E. coli and salmonella. Bats: Though these pests are associated with nearby Austin, they also exist around San Antonio. They can possibly spread disease through their feces. Rodents: Mice and rats can sneak into your home through tiny spaces to nest, eating through packages of food, leaving droppings, and chewing through electrical wires and insulation. Scorpions: You may find these common Texas pests in your basement or bathrooms. Their stings may require medical attention. Spiders: While many types of local spiders are harmless, bites from brown recluse spiders and black widow spiders may necessitate a trip to the hospital. Termites: Termites can cause thousands of dollars in structural damage in a small amount of time, leaving your home in need of serious repairs. Bedbugs: These nocturnal bloodsuckers are notoriously difficult to get rid of on your own and are very common in the greater San Antonio area. Left untreated, bedbugs can infest entire rooms of your home.

How to Choose Pest Control in San Antonio

Here are the most important points to consider when weighing which pest control company is best for you and your pest situation:

Type of pests: Each company offers different general pest control plans. If you already know what pests have taken over your home, make sure they are included in the company’s plan options. Cost: The size of your home, its location, and the type of pests you are dealing with will affect the overall cost of services. Some companies are more expensive than others, but they typically offer unique services or more coverage. You may want a cheaper plan if you require only minimal treatment. Some companies also offer discounts on annual plans. Reputation: Reading about a company from expert reviews can help give you a sense of whether a company is reliable, competent, and trustworthy. Customer reviews from TrustPilot and Google can also give you a realistic look at each company’s customer service. Plan schedules: We suggest at least a quarterly treatment plan, but plans are also offered on a monthly, bi-monthly or one-time basis. Guarantees: A satisfaction guarantee is a sign of good customer service. Orkin and Terminix offer to return to your home if you see any pests between scheduled appointments to re-treat at no extra cost. Orkin and Terminix even offer to refund your last treatment if you aren’t 100 percent satisfied.

How much should pest control cost?

The overall cost of a treatment plan will vary depending on where you live, the size of your home, the type of pest you’re dealing with, the size of the infestation, and the type and number of treatments needed. For general pest control for a 2,000-square-foot home, Orkin charges $790 to $980, and Terminix charges between $550 and $700.

What attracts bats to your house?

If you have plants that attract nocturnal insects to your house and yard, there is a chance that bats may be drawn to your home, too. If bats are able to enter your attic, they may start nesting there.

What can I spray around my house to keep bugs out?

A popular DIY pest control solution is a solution of apple cider vinegar and water sprayed around your home. This can deter some pests, but for the most effective pest control it is better to receive service from a professional.

How do I prepare my home for pest control?

In general, we recommend that you clean your bedding, carpets and floors, and furniture. You may also want to move any larger furniture away from any walls. Be sure to check with your pest control provider to see what else they suggest.

Pest Control Company Methodology

The This Old House Reviews Team is committed to providing unbiased and comprehensive reviews for our readers. This means earning your trust through transparency and having the data to back up our ratings and recommendations. With that in mind, we spent time creating an objective rating system to score each pest control company. Here’s what that review process looks like:

We contact every pest control company via phone and online chat (if available), talking to representatives. We get quotes, ask questions and fully understand each company’s pest control plans. We test the customer service, including factors such as wait times, friendliness and problem-solving ability. We check and update all of the data and metrics on the companies on a regular basis to ensure we have the most current and accurate information.

With all of that data, we created a rating system to score each pest control company. Our rating system is a weighted, 100-point scale on the following factors:

Plan options (35): Every home and every pest problem requires specific prevention and remediation. Companies with multiple plans and service offerings were given higher scores than those without. State Availability (5): Your location determines which providers are available. Companies available in more states were rated higher than those with less. Trustworthiness (15): We consider companies that offer service guarantees more trustworthy and therefore scored them higher. Customer Service (35): This factor is based on our own research from calling providers, as well as their availability and guarantees for responses. Additional Benefits (10): Companies that provide information about the products they use, have an app for customers, and offer other benefits were given higher ratings.
